Problem Statement
There are points on the plane. All pairwise distances between two points have been recorded.
A single record has been erased. Is it always possible to restore it using the remaining records?
Suppose no three points are on a line, and records were erased. What is the maximum value of such that restoration of all the erased records is always possible?
